What is Lightroom iOS?

Lightroom iOS is a mobile version of Adobe’s industry-leading photo editor — Adobe Lightroom — optimized for Apple devices. Available on the App Store, the app allows you to edit photos on i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ch using advanced features such as AI denoise, tone curve, healing brush, and masking.

The Lightroom app for iOS is not just a simple photo editor; it’s an ecosystem. It syncs your photos with the Lightroom desktop and Lightroom web versions, so you can start editing on your iPhone and finish on your Mac or Windows PC.With every new update, including the Lightroom mobile 2025 release, Adobe adds features like Generative Fill, AI-based noise reduction, and HDR export, giving iOS users the same power as professional desktop editors.

Features of Lightroom iOS (2025 Edition)

AI-Powered Editing Tools

The Lightroom iOS 2025 update introduces next-generation AI-powered tools that completely transform mobile photo editing. With advanced AI Denoise, Generative Fill, and smart masking, users can edit with desktop-level precision right from their iPhone or iPad. The Lightroom mobile AI denoise feature intelligently removes grain and visual noise while retaining natural details and textures. This is particularly useful for night photography or images taken in low light. Similarly, the Generative Fill function uses artificial intelligence to seamlessly remove or replace unwanted objects, expanding image boundaries with realistic results. These features make Lightroom mobile more intuitive and efficient for both beginners and professionals who demand quality and speed.

Healing Brush and Object Removal

Retouching has never been easier with the new Lightroom mobile healing brush. This feature allows you to remove small imperfections such as blemishes, dust, or distractions from your photos. The 2025 version elevates this capability by introducing AI-powered object removal, similar to Photoshop’s popular Generative Fill. Now, you can remove people, wires, or entire objects with just a few taps, and Lightroom intelligently fills the background to maintain natural consistency. Whether you’re editing portraits, landscapes, or product photos, the Lightroom mobile healing brush ensures that every image looks polished and professional — without requiring complex editing skills.

Masking and Selective Adjustments

The masking and selective adjustment tools in Lightroom iOS have evolved into something extraordinary. With AI assistance, Lightroom can now automatically detect subjects, skies, and backgrounds, allowing users to make precise adjustments with minimal effort. Want to brighten a face, darken a sky, or enhance background blur? The Lightroom mobile masking feature lets you isolate those areas and apply unique settings to each. This feature brings the power of layer-based editing to your smartphone, allowing fine control over every part of an image. The AI-powered detection ensures faster workflows, giving photographers more time to focus on creativity instead of manual selections.

RAW Editing Support

For photographers who prefer shooting in RAW format, Lightroom iOS offers complete support for uncompressed file types like DNG, CR2, and NEF. This means you can capture, edit, and export professional-quality images directly from your iPhone or iPad without sacrificing detail. The Lightroom mobile RAW workflow gives you total control over exposure, highlights, and color temperature, making it ideal for professionals working in travel, fashion, or commercial photography. Combined with Lightroom mobile HDR and AI denoise, the results are crisp, detailed, and color-accurate — rivaling desktop edits in every way.

Watermark and Export Customization

Protecting creative work is essential, and Lightroom iOS watermark customization makes it effortless. The built-in watermark tool allows users to brand their photos by adding text or logo marks with adjustable opacity, size, and placement. This is especially valuable for photographers, influencers, or digital artists who share their content publicly. Beyond watermarking, Lightroom offers full export customization — letting you choose file formats like JPEG, PNG, or DNG, adjust quality levels, and select color profiles (sRGB, AdobeRGB, etc.). Whether you’re exporting for print or web, Lightroom ensures each image meets your exact specifications.

How to Download Lightroom iOS (Free & Premium)

Downloading Lightroom iOS is simple:

  1. Open the App Store on your iPhone or iPad.
  2. Search for “Adobe Lightroom Photo Editor”.
  3. Tap Get to download the free version.
  4. Sign in using your Adobe ID or create one.
  5. Upgrade to Lightroom iOS Premium within the app if you need advanced features.

If you’re looking for older releases, you can also find Lightroom app old versions on trusted third-party archives, though Adobe recommends using the latest version for the best stability and security.

Using Lightroom on iPhone – A Quick Tutorial

To get started with Lightroom on iPhone, import your photos from the camera roll or capture directly using the Lightroom mobile camera. Then:

  1. Adjust Exposure & Contrast using the Light and Color panels.
  2. Enhance Details using Noise Reduction, Clarity, or Texture tools.
  3. Crop & Straighten images for perfect composition using Guided Upright or Golden Ratio grid.
  4. Add Presets for one-tap edits.
  5. Export or Share using Instagram settings or custom export profiles.

This workflow makes it easy for anyone to produce professional-quality images without needing a desktop setup.

Common Issues & Fixes

Lightroom iOS Not Syncing

If your Lightroom iOS app is not syncing, check your Adobe Cloud status or ensure a stable internet connection. Re-signing into your Adobe ID often resolves syncing problems.

Lightroom Mobile Taking Forever to Export

This usually happens with large RAW files or insufficient device storage. Try reducing export resolution or clearing Lightroom cache.

Lightroom Mobile Not Importing Presets

Ensure your preset files are in .XMP format and stored locally on your iPhone or iCloud Drive before importing through Lightroom settings.

App Crashing or Not Opening

If Lightroom app keeps crashing, update to the latest version or reinstall from the App Store. iOS 16 or higher is recommended for optimal performance.
